"Deadly Conversations" is the tale of what happens when Zan Miller meets Mykhalo, a three hundred year old Bavarian vampire. She tries to keep the relationship casual but suddenly finds herself beset by problems only he can solve. Complicating matters further is her teen-aged daughter Bree who questions her faith and battles the gift of magic inherited from a very old power. Bree holds the secret to ending Mykhalo's torment... but at what cost to her mother?

A Wiccan witch and a Vampire walk into a coffee shop.... No, this is not the start of a bad joke. On the contrary, this is the beginning of a great book. Zan and Mykhalo make an unusual couple. Throw in her teenage daughter and an Egyptian goddess, and you have an interesting set up.

The title is Deadly Conversations, with a heavy emphasis on the conversation part. Which is why I rated it a 4. The world building could have been broken up a bit more with action. But as the witch and the vampire compare notes on what is myth and what is the truth about their kind, the story moves smoothly. Knowing next to nothing about the Wiccan faith, I was not bored. And of course, I am always intrigued with what an author will do with the vampire tradition.

The editing could do with a tweak. Lots of misplaced commas.

Overall, I really enjoyed this book and have already purchased the second in the series,Whispers of Life.
